Preseason results rarely matter in the long run, but when the scoreboard shows 38-0 as it did Sunday for the Buffalo Bills in a loss to the Chicago Bears, it's hard to simply shrug it off. Coach Sean McDermott didn't mince words after the blowout, saying the performance from his reserves fell well short of expectations.
Caleb Williams took advantage of his first preseason playing time. He connected with Olamide Zaccheaus for a 36-yard touchdown on the opening drive as the Chicago Bears cruised to 38-0 preseason victory over the Buffalo Bills on Sunday night.

The Buffalo Bills suffered a brutal 38-0 beatdown at the hands of the Chicago Bears at Soldier Field on Sunday in their second preseason game. “Certainly not up to our standard, what we expect,” coach Sean McDermott said. “Got a lot of work to do. That’s very clear.”
